General Information: This strain was isolated from a cystic fibrosis patient. These bacteria present great versatility to adapt to diverse environments, and are capable of degrading pollutants in water and soil, and fixing atmospheric nitrogen. This species include strains isolated from cystic fibrosis patients as well as strains with potential use in biocontrol.
